  • Mexico confirmed this Thursday the arrest of Ovidio Guzmán, son of Joaquín 'El Chapo' Guzmán, who is considered one of the leaders of the Sinaloa cartel, and

    for whose capture the United States offered 5 million dollars.

  • The high-profile arrest occurred early Thursday morning in Culiacán, Sinaloa (northern Mexico) and sparked violent episodes: blocked roads, shootings that left several officers injured, vehicle fires.

    An Aeroméxico plane was even shot at.

  • Ovidio Guzmán

    had already been arrested in 2019

    , but at that time the authorities released him after saying that they sought to stop the violence after his arrest.

This was the violent military operation to recapture Ovidio Guzmán, alias 'El Ratón'

General Sandoval, Mexico's Secretary of Defense, reported Thursday from the National Palace in the capital that

the operation was the result of a six-month investigative effort between various

local and federal government agencies and that it was carried out by agents of the National Guard and the Army.
